Overview

SN74GTLP21395DGVR from Texas Instruments is a dual 1-bit LVTTL-to-GTLP adjustable-edge-rate bus transceiver with split LVTTL port, feedback path, and selectable polarity. It provides bidirectional signal-level translation between 3.3-V LVTTL logic (5-V tolerant) and GTLP backplane signals (VTT = 1.5 V, VREF = 1 V), supports live insertion via Ioff, power-up 3-state, and BIAS VCC, and delivers 100 mA GTLP output drive for incident-wave switching into 11-Ω backplane loads - used in IEEE 1394 backplane PHY interfaces and high-reliability multislot systems.

For engineers reviewing the SN74GTLP21395DGVR datasheet, SN74GTLP21395DGVR pinout, SN74GTLP21395DGVR application, or SN74GTLP21395DGVR equivalent, key selection criteria include GTLP/LVTTL level translation capability, ERC-controlled edge rates (fast/slow), true/complement polarity selection, TI-OPC™ ringing suppression, OEC™ signal integrity enhancement, and support for hot-plug operation in distributed backplane environments.

Technical Context

This device implements two independent 1-bit transceivers, each with separate A (LVTTL input), B (GTLP I/O), and Y (LVTTL output) terminals, enabling transparent or inverted data flow with dedicated OEAB (B-port enable), OEBY (Y-output enable), and T/C (polarity control) inputs. The split LVTTL port provides real-time feedback for diagnostics and control monitoring without requiring external routing.

TI-OPC™ circuitry actively limits overshoot on unevenly loaded backplanes during low-to-high transitions, while OEC™ improves signal integrity and reduces EMI. Adjustable edge-rate control (ERC) selects fast (ERC = L) or slow (ERC = H) B-port rise/fall times - 1.3 ns/2.6 ns (fast) or 2.5 ns/3.0 ns (slow) - to balance data-transfer rate and signal fidelity across varying backplane impedances.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Supply voltage (VCC) 3.15 V to 3.45 V - ensures stable GTLP/LVTTL interface operation with ±3% tolerance around 3.3 V nominal.
GTLP output drive 100 mA sink - enables incident-wave switching into heavily loaded backplanes down to 11 Ω equivalent impedance.
LVTTL I/O drive ±12 mA - compatible with standard 5-V-tolerant LVTTL logic and supports feedback-path signaling.
B-port edge rate control ERC input selects fast (1.3 ns tr / 2.6 ns tf) or slow (2.5 ns tr / 3.0 ns tf) - optimizes timing margin vs. EMI in distributed loads.
Live-insertion support Ioff < 10 µA at VCC = 0 V, power-up 3-state, and BIAS VCC precharge - prevents backflow current and backplane disturbance during card insertion/removal.
Signal integrity features TI-OPC™ (ringing suppression) and OEC™ (EMI reduction) - validated across JEDEC JESD 8-3 GTLP-compliant backplane models.
Operating temperature –40°C to +85°C - qualified for industrial and embedded backplane applications including VME, CPCI, and FB+ systems.

Pinout & Package

SN74GTLP21395DGVR uses a 20-pin TVSOP (Thin Very Small Outline Package) with 0.4 mm pitch, body size 4.4 mm × 6.5 mm, and thermal performance θJA = 83°C/W. Pin numbering follows standard DGV/DW/PW top-view orientation.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1Y, 2Y LVTTL output (feedback path) Provides diagnostic visibility into B-port data; driven by internal transceiver logic and controlled by OEBY.
1A, 2A LVTTL input (A-side) 5-V tolerant LVTTL logic input; connects to host controller or link-layer interface (e.g., TSB14AA1 CTL/DATA lines).
1B, 2B GTLP bidirectional I/O (B-side) Backplane-facing GTLP signal terminal; supports 100 mA drive and differential input reference via VREF.
1OEAB, 2OEAB B-port output-enable (active-low) Controls GTLP driver state; tied together in typical 1394 PHY interface to OCDOE/TDOE signals.
1OEBY, 2OEBY Y-output enable (active-low) Enables/disables LVTTL feedback outputs; typically grounded to maintain continuous receive capability.
1T/C, 2T/C Polarity control (true/complement) Selects inversion mode: high = true path (A→B, B→Y), low = complement path (¬A→B, ¬B→Y).
ERC Edge-rate control input Logic-high = slow edge rate (2.5 ns/3.0 ns); logic-low = fast edge rate (1.3 ns/2.6 ns) - sets B-port slew for load optimization.
VREF GTLP differential input reference Set to 1 V for GTLP operation (2/3 of VTT = 1.5 V); critical for noise margin and input threshold stability.
BIAS VCC Backplane I/O precharge supply Connected to 3.3 V to precondition B-port pins before VCC ramp-up - essential for live-insertion compliance.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Adjustable edge-rate control (ERC) Two discrete slew settings (fast/slow) allow system-level tuning of GTLP rise/fall times to match backplane trace impedance and length.
Integrated 26-Ω series termination Y outputs include built-in 26-Ω resistors - eliminates need for external series resistors and reduces PCB component count and layout complexity.
Split LVTTL port with feedback path Dedicated A-input and Y-output per channel enable real-time monitoring of backplane data without interrupting primary signal flow.
TI-OPC™ active ringing suppression Dynamic overshoot limiting on GTLP outputs during low-to-high transitions - maintains signal integrity on unterminated or unevenly loaded backplanes.
OEC™ electromagnetic compatibility Output equalization circuitry reduces harmonic content and radiated emissions - improves EMC performance in dense backplane systems.

FAQ

What is the primary function of the SN74GTLP21395DGVR in a backplane system?

The SN74GTLP21395DGVR serves as a dual 1-bit bidirectional level translator between 3.3-V LVTTL logic and GTLP backplane signals. It enables high-speed (up to 100 Mbps) communication between host controllers (e.g., TSB14AA1) and GTLP backplanes while providing feedback monitoring, polarity selection, and live-insertion support - all critical for IEEE 1394 backplane PHY implementations.

How does the ERC pin affect timing performance of the SN74GTLP21395DGVR?

The ERC pin on the SN74GTLP21395DGVR selects between two discrete edge-rate modes: ERC = L yields fast B-port rise/fall times (1.3 ns / 2.6 ns), while ERC = H yields slower edges (2.5 ns / 3.0 ns). This adjustment directly impacts signal integrity and timing margin - faster edges increase data rate potential but raise EMI risk; slower edges improve noise immunity in heavily loaded or unterminated backplanes.

Can the SN74GTLP21395DGVR operate with GTL (1.2 V VTT) instead of GTLP (1.5 V VTT)?

Yes, the SN74GTLP21395DGVR supports both GTL (VTT = 1.2 V, VREF = 0.8 V) and GTLP (VTT = 1.5 V, VREF = 1.0 V) signaling standards. Its AC specifications are published for GTLP, but DC characteristics remain valid across both - allowing flexible deployment in legacy GTL systems or newer GTLP designs without hardware change.

What is the role of the BIAS VCC pin in SN74GTLP21395DGVR live-insertion operation?

The BIAS VCC pin on the SN74GTLP21395DGVR supplies precharge current to the GTLP B-port I/O pins before main VCC ramps up. When connected to 3.3 V prior to VCC, it conditions the backplane interface to prevent transient disturbances during card insertion - a mandatory requirement for compliant hot-plug operation in IEEE 1394 and VME64x systems.

Does the SN74GTLP21395DGVR require external series resistors on its Y outputs?

No, the SN74GTLP21395DGVR integrates equivalent 26-Ω series resistors on all Y outputs. This eliminates the need for external termination components, reduces PCB footprint, and ensures consistent impedance matching for LVTTL feedback paths - simplifying layout and improving signal fidelity without design overhead.
